NG60 FLV is a 2011 Suzuki Swift in Red with a 1,328c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 16 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 81.3%.
Across all 2011 Suzuki Swift models, the average MOT pass rate is 78.2% with a typical mileage of 55,912 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Suzuki Swift f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 45,954 recorded failures. If you're considering buying NG60 FLV,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Suzuki Swift typically stays on UK roads for around 31 years. At 15 years old, this Suzuki Swift is still in the earlier part of its expected life.
